Tejon Ranch, one of California's most ambitious master-planned communities, presents a unique blend of residential living, commercial centers, and vast open spaces. For 2026, the development offers a compelling option for homebuyers seeking newer homes within a structured community, featuring a range of housing options from the $500,000s to over $1 million, alongside amenities like parks, trails, and upcoming retail centers. This guide provides an objective overview of what potential residents can expect, focusing on the practical aspects of location, property types, and associated costs.

What is the Location and Vision of Tejon Ranch? Located at the junction of Kern and Los Angeles counties, Tejon Ranch benefits from its proximity to major transport routes like the I-5 highway. The development is conceived as a master-planned community, a comprehensively designed area that integrates housing, commerce, and recreation. The long-term vision aims to create a sustainable environment, reducing reliance on long-distance commuting to areas like Bakersfield or the Los Angeles basin. What Types of Homes and Communities Are Available? The residential offerings within Tejon Ranch primarily consist of single-family detached homes built by national and regional builders. Prospective buyers can find a variety of architectural styles, typically including modern farmhouse and Mediterranean influences. Many homes are part of a Homeowners Association (HOA), an organization that manages common areas and enforces community rules, with fees covering landscape maintenance and access to community facilities like pools and parks. It is crucial for buyers to review the HOA's covenants, conditions, and restrictions (CC&Rs) to understand the rules governing property modifications and usage.

What are the Financial Considerations, Including Property Tax? Understanding the full financial picture is critical. Beyond the home's sale price, buyers must budget for recurring costs. Property Tax is an ad valorem tax levied by local governments based on the assessed value of the property. In California, thanks to Proposition 13, the base tax rate is typically 1% of the purchase price, with additional voter-approved levies potentially bringing the total rate to around 1.1% to 1.25% annually. For a home purchased at $700,000, this translates to an estimated annual property tax of approximately $7,700 to $8,750. HOA fees are an additional monthly expense that can range from $100 to $300, depending on the amenities offered.

What is the Outlook for Amenities and Appreciation? A significant advantage of a master-planned community is the deliberate allocation of space for schools, parks, and commercial development. For 2026, the continued build-out of retail and recreational facilities is a key factor for resident convenience and potential property value growth. However, property appreciation is not guaranteed and is influenced by broader market conditions, interest rates, and the pace of the community's development. Based on our experience assessment, the value of a home in Tejon Ranch will be tied to the successful execution of the long-term development plan and the overall health of the California real estate market.

In summary, Tejon Ranch represents a modern approach to community development in California. Prospective buyers should prioritize reviewing all HOA documents thoroughly before committing to a purchase. It is also essential to factor in the total monthly cost, including mortgage, property tax, and HOA fees, to ensure affordability. Finally, consider the current state of amenities against your family's immediate needs, as some planned features may be in various stages of completion throughout 2026.
